Lydgate Beach Park Volunteer Cleanup
Teams of volunteers helped clean organic debris and litter from Lydgate Beach Park in Kapa’a April 20 for Earth Day. Tommy Noyes, general coordinator for Friends of Kamalani and Lydgate Park, headed the effort, and also coordinates volunteers year-round for park cleanups. In addition to treats and snacks, breadfruit trees donated by National Tropical Botanical Gardens Breadfruit Institute were part of the swag. To learn more, go to kamalani.org.
